What is 0ne forth plus three eights?

To add 1/4 and 3/8, you first need to change 1/4 to show a denominator of 8 which would be 2/8. You can then add 2/8 + 3/8 to get 5/8.

What does the associative property of addtion mean?

If you are adding three or more numbers together, it doesn't matter which ones you add together first. For example: 3 + 4 + 1 Add the 3 and 4 to get 7, then add the 1 to get 8. Add the 4 and 1 to get 5, then add the 3 to get 8. Add the 3 and 1 to get 4, then add the 4 to get 8. In each case, the end result was always 8.
